Environmental site assessment of Texas landscape with a field of blue bonnets.When is an Environmental Site Assessment Phase I Required?

As part of the Comprehensive Environmental Response, Compensation and Liability Act (CERCLA), Phase I ESAs are typically required during commercial real-estate transactions and are meant to gather information to develop an independent scientific opinion about the environmental condition of the property. ESAs attempt to identify the presence of hazardous materials and/or petroleum products and if there is a material threat of release or a past release. This information will inform on the need for further investigation, such as a Phase II ESA.

 

 

When is an Environmental Site Assessment Phase II Required?

A Phase II ESA is completed if evidence of a potential release or environmental conditions are identified and/or known to have occurred at a site. Information gathered during a Phase I ESA will inform on and focus Phase II investigative efforts.
